State Parks: Exploring Natural Beauty
Texas boasts more than 90 state parks, each offering unique landscapes and recreational opportunities.
- Big Bend National Park: This stunning park features hiking trails, river activities, and breathtaking views of the Chisos Mountains. Families can enjoy camping, stargazing, and wildlife spotting.
- Palo Duro Canyon State Park: Known as the second-largest canyon in the United States, Palo Duro offers hiking, biking, and horseback riding along scenic trails. The park also hosts the outdoor musical “Texas,” which tells the story of the state’s history.
- Guadalupe Mountains National Park: This park features the highest peaks in Texas and offers excellent hiking opportunities, including the challenging trail to the summit of Guadalupe Peak.

Historical Sites: Learning About Texas Heritage
Visiting historical sites can be both educational and entertaining for families.
- The Alamo: A visit to this iconic site in San Antonio provides insight into Texas history. Families can explore the grounds, learn about the Battle of the Alamo, and view artifacts.
- The San Jacinto Battleground: This historical site commemorates Texas’s independence from Mexico and offers educational exhibits, reenactments, and a chance to climb the San Jacinto Monument for stunning views.
- The Fort Worth Stockyards: Families can enjoy a glimpse of Texas’s cowboy heritage with cattle drives, rodeos, and Western-themed shops.

- The Texas State Fair: Held annually in Dallas, the State Fair is a celebration of Texas culture, featuring rides, games, live entertainment, and delicious food, making it an unforgettable experience for families.Festivals and Events: Celebrating Texas Culture
Texas is known for its vibrant festivals and events that bring communities together and celebrate the state’s rich heritage. Participating in these events can be an enriching experience for families.
- Texas Renaissance Festival: Held annually in Todd Mission, this festival transports families to the medieval era with jousting, live performances, artisan crafts, and themed activities. Kids can enjoy interactive games and even meet characters in costumes, making it a fun-filled day for all ages.
- Houston Livestock Show and Rodeo: This iconic event is one of the largest livestock shows in the world and features rodeo competitions, concerts, and a carnival. Families can enjoy petting zoos, agricultural exhibits, and delicious food, making it a true Texas experience.
- Fiesta San Antonio: This annual spring festival celebrates the city’s diverse culture, complete with parades, music, and food. Families can participate in various activities, including arts and crafts and cultural performances, while enjoying the vibrant atmosphere.
